Auburn Basketball

Auburn's season has gone off the rails recently. The Tigers are 14-11 overall and 5-7 in the SEC, and they're in the midst of a four-game losing streak, with Keyshawn Hall suspended indefinitely by Steven Pearl.

However, it sounds like things are trending in the right direction for Hall to play at Mississippi State. Coach Pearl said on Tuesday, "He had a great practice yesterday, and he's out there getting shots now. Hope for another great practice today."

It's hard to believe this team won at Florida less than a month ago, but it was able to do so because it took high-percentage 2-pointers as opposed to low-percentage 3s.

Tahaad Pettiford is finally playing consistent high-level basketball and is averaging 25 points over his past three games. He's done a really nice job getting downhill off the pick-and-roll, which has led to high-quality looks. Against Arkansas, seven of his 11 made shots came off the pick-and-roll.

KeShawn Murphy has been stout on the glass for Auburn, grabbing 12 boards in two of the past three games. He returns to Mississippi State, where his athleticism attacking the offensive glass will be relied on against a Mississippi State frontcourt that's been prone to allowing offensive rebounds.

Mississippi State Basketball

Mississippi State is 12-13 overall and 4-8 in the SEC. The Bulldogs are also coming off a win over Ole Miss to snap a three-game losing streak.

Since the beginning of conference play, Mississippi State has the 38th-best defense in the country, according to Bart Torvik, and is holding opponents to 29.7% from 3.

However, offensively, Mississippi State is mainly Josh Hubbard. In the win against Ole Miss, Hubbard had 32 points and shot 12-of-16 from the field and 4-for-6 from 3.

As a team, the Bulldogs are near the bottom in almost every offensive category outside of tempo. If they want to pull off the upset, they're going to need other players to step up and take the load off of Hubbard's back.

Auburn vs. Mississippi State Betting Analysis

This matchup is interesting to me, as Auburn has the 12th-best offense in the country since the start of SEC play (via Bart Torvik) despite how poorly it has shot from 3.

Meanwhile, Mississippi State is 4-8 in the SEC, but it has a top-40 defense in the same span (via Bart Torvik).

Pettiford is playing his best basketball right now, and Murphy is returning to Mississippi State fresh off a 20-and-10 double-double.

With the possibility that Hall returns, I expect Auburn to end its four-game losing streak with a big time offensive performance.
